Blues Seek to Maintain European Momentum as Qarabag Prepare for a Historic Night in Baku

 


The UEFA Champions League 2025/26 continues to deliver thrilling matchups, and this week’s spotlight is on Qarabag vs Chelsea, a captivating encounter that blends contrasting footballing worlds — a European powerhouse against a determined underdog. Scheduled for Wednesday evening at 7:45 PM, this game promises passion, tactics, and high stakes.

🔵 Chelsea’s Confidence on the Rise

Chelsea enter this fixture full of momentum after recording two convincing victories in their previous group-stage outings. Their latest 5-1 triumph over Ajax showcased not only attacking fluidity but also a newfound confidence that manager Enzo Maresca has successfully instilled. The Italian’s tactical flexibility has brought out the best in his players, combining pressing intensity with creativity.

The London side currently sits comfortably in second place in the group standings, but Maresca knows that maintaining focus is crucial, especially away from home. “Every match in Europe tests your mentality,” he said in the pre-match conference. “We respect Qarabag, but we’re here to win.”

🇦🇿 Qarabag’s Dream of an Upset

Qarabag, the pride of Azerbaijani football, are embracing the underdog tag with pride. Although their Champions League journey has been challenging — with just one point from three games — their performances have earned admiration for their tactical discipline and determination.

Coach Gurban Gurbanov has built a cohesive unit that thrives on teamwork rather than star power. With players like Owusu Kwabena, Zoubir, and Toral Bayramov, Qarabag are capable of catching Chelsea off-guard, especially in front of their passionate home supporters.

⚔️ What to Expect on the Pitch

Chelsea are expected to control the game through midfield dominance, led by Moises Caicedo and Enzo Fernández, while Cole Palmer and Mykhailo Mudryk will look to exploit spaces behind Qarabag’s defense. However, the physical conditions and long travel to Azerbaijan may pose minor challenges for the visitors.

Qarabag’s best chance lies in staying compact, frustrating Chelsea’s attack, and capitalizing on set-pieces or counterattacks. Their goalkeeper, Shakhrudin Magomedaliyev, will have to be at his best to deny Chelsea’s lethal finishing.

🌍 Historical Context and Motivation

Interestingly, Chelsea have fond memories of playing in Baku — the same city where they triumphed 4-1 over Arsenal in the 2019 Europa League Final. That victory remains symbolic of Chelsea’s European pedigree, and returning to Azerbaijan could reignite that spirit.

For Qarabag, hosting a team of Chelsea’s caliber is not only a footballing challenge but also a celebration of their growth on the European stage. The club’s consistent appearances in UEFA competitions over the past decade have made them a symbol of national pride.
